Sector benchmark
What Youth Development executives earn in Washington
LA CENTER BOOSTER CLUB reported no executive compensation in its latest filing. For context, the highest-paid executive at a comparable youth development organization in Washington earns a median of $88,000.
25th percentile
$36k
Median
$88,000
75th percentile
$134k
90th percentile
$191k
These are youth development s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 167 organizations across 167 filings (2022 – 2024).
